[bug] recherche dans description HTML ne sépare pas bien les mots

J’ai un événement avec la description suivante (je ne mets que la partie intéressante)

<p>Sur réservation - voir les infos pratiques sur le site de la Mairie de La Garenne Colombes</p><p></p><p><em>Spider man : New generation</em></p>

À noter que la description a été copiée-collée du site de l’organisateur.

Si je cherche « man », « Garenne », je trouve cet événement
Si je recherche « colombes », « Spider » il ne trouve pas cet événement.

Je pense que cela vient du fait que lors de l’indexation les balises HTML ne sont pas considérées comme des séparateurs de mot. Colombes</p><p></p><p><em>Spider devient alors « ColombesSpider » et le moteur de recherche textuel ne sait pas trop quoi en faire.

Si j’intéroge la nase de données avec select * from event_search where id=xx, je trouve en effet une entrée 'colombesspid':22C. Le moteur de recherche a tenté de créer un verbe avec les deux mots accolés.

Normalement corrigé dans https://framagit.org/framasoft/mobilizon/-/merge_requests/520, merci !